Zagreb airports
Zagreb Airport (ZAG), also known as Franjo Tuđman Airport, is the primary international airport serving Zagreb, Croatia. Located approximately 12 km southeast of the city center, it is the largest and busiest airport in Croatia. ZAG serves as a hub for Croatia Airlines and offers numerous flights to major European cities, as well as some destinations further afield. The airport features a modern terminal building with a variety of amenities, including shops, restaurants, and car rental services. Getting to and from the airport is convenient, with options like taxis, buses, and ride-sharing services readily available. ZAG provides a gateway to Zagreb and the rest of Croatia, ensuring smooth travels for both domestic and international passengers.

Other airports
While Zagreb Airport (ZAG) is the primary gateway, consider nearby airports like Ljubljana (LJU) or Graz (GRZ) for potentially cheaper flights. The downside? You'll need to factor in ground transportation to Zagreb, which can be a bus ride from Ljubljana (around 2 hours) or a combination of train and bus from Graz (3-4 hours). Weigh the flight savings against the travel time and cost to reach Zagreb city center.

What to Do in Zagreb
Zagreb isn’t just about getting there – it’s about enjoying the country once you arrive! Here are some top things to do in Zagreb, organized by interest:
Sightseeing & landmarks
Zagreb is a city brimming with historical landmarks and captivating sights! Explore the iconic Zagreb Cathedral, wander through the charming Upper Town with its cobblestone streets, and don't miss the whimsical Museum of Broken Relationships for a unique experience.
Arts & culture
Immerse yourself in Zagreb's vibrant arts and culture scene. Visit the Mimara Museum to admire its diverse collection, catch a performance at the Croatian National Theatre, or explore the numerous galleries showcasing contemporary and traditional art.
Food & nightlife
Zagreb offers a delightful culinary journey and exciting nightlife! Indulge in traditional Croatian dishes at local konobas, sample craft beers at trendy bars, and experience the lively atmosphere of Tkalčićeva Street, filled with cafes and restaurants.
Shopping & fashion
Discover Zagreb's shopping scene, from local designs to international brands. Explore the Dolac Market for fresh produce and local crafts, browse the boutiques on Ilica Street, and find unique souvenirs to remember your trip.
Nearby getaways
Escape the city and explore the beautiful surroundings of Zagreb. Visit the picturesque Plitvice Lakes National Park, explore the historic town of Samobor, or enjoy a relaxing day at the thermal spas in Hrvatsko Zagorje.
